Which ignition system components are used in the Cessna 172 for improved performance?

Explanation:
The Cessna 172 is equipped with two magnetos, which significantly enhance engine performance and reliability. This dual ignition system provides redundancy; if one magneto fails, the engine can still operate on the other magneto. Additionally, having two magnetos allows for better combustion efficiency, as they ignite the fuel-air mixture at slightly different times. This results in a more complete combustion process, improving overall engine performance and providing a smoother operation. The presence of two magnetos also contributes to a more reliable ignition setup, as both systems can be tested and monitored during pre-flight checks. Pilots can observe the RPM drop when switching from both magnetos to one, ensuring that both units are functioning correctly. This dual setup is a standard feature in many aircraft because it not only enhances performance but also increases safety in case of a malfunction.
